Population Overview
Pondera Colony CDP is a small community located in Montana. The total population is 47. It ranks as the 380th most populous out of 470 cities and towns in Montana.
Age Demographics
The median age in Pondera Colony CDP is 35.4 years. This is 12% lower than the state median of 40.2 years. With 36.2% of the population under 18, Pondera Colony CDP has a notably young demographic profile, suggesting a family-oriented community.

Race & Ethnicity
Pondera Colony CDP is a highly diverse community where no single racial or ethnic group constitutes a majority of the population. White (non-Hispanic) residents account for 25.5%. The White (non-Hispanic) population (25.5%) is well below the state average of 84.1%. The Hispanic or Latino population is significantly higher than the state average (38.3% vs 4.4%).

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Pondera Colony CDP, Montana is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Montana state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 470 Census-designated places in Montana.
